Output 856a6ba5e47403668f2312ff8a4bd42af487b1c01f2fc7765e8cdc05dd8e63b2:13

value
15868677
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 539b6153864eb5d295fa8b376731bd2dd000f05b OP_EQUALVERIFY OP_CHECKSIG
address
18d5DviZmwLu8stRC5YfeJgZ81F9yVUdAM
transaction
856a6ba5e47403668f2312ff8a4bd42af487b1c01f2fc7765e8cdc05dd8e63b2
spent
true